On 13/06/18 23:15, Stefano Stabellini wrote:
Similar to construct_dom0, construct_domU creates a barebone DomU guest.
Default to 1 max vcpu and 64MB of memory if not specified otherwise.
The device tree node passed as argument is compatible "xen,domU", see
docs/misc/arm/device-tree/booting.txt.
Allocate all vcpus on cpu0 initially.
I don't think this comment is true. __construct_domain will allocate
vCPUs in cycle.

+int __init construct_domU(struct domain *d, struct dt_device_node *node)
+{
+ struct kernel_info kinfo = {};
+ int rc;
+ const char *cpus = NULL, *mem = NULL;
+
+ printk("*** LOADING DOMU ***\n");
+
+ d->max_vcpus = 1;
+ rc = dt_property_read_string(node, "cpus", &cpus);
+ if ( !rc )
+ d->max_vcpus = simple_strtoul(cpus, &cpus, 0);
+
+ kinfo.unassigned_mem = MB(64);
+ rc = dt_property_read_string(node, "mem", &mem);
+ if ( !rc )
+ kinfo.unassigned_mem = parse_size_and_unit(mem, &mem);
+
+ d->vcpu = xzalloc_array(struct vcpu *, d->max_vcpus);
+ if ( !d->vcpu )
+ return -ENOMEM;;
+ if ( alloc_vcpu(d, 0, 0) == NULL )
+ return -ENOMEM;
+ d->max_pages = ~0U;
+
+ kinfo.d = d;
+
+ rc = kernel_probe_domU(&kinfo, node);
+ if ( rc < 0 )
+ return rc;
+
+ d->arch.type = kinfo.type;
+ allocate_memory(d, &kinfo);
allocate_memory() will allocate direct mapped memory but you impose a
static memory layout for the guest. Both are not going to work very well
together.
So you probably want to extend allocate_memory to support allocating
memory for a given region.
+
+ return __construct_domain(d, &kinfo);
+}
